Details

This projects main aim is to design and build an IoT system for microplastics detection and characterization that addresses the existing limitations for in-situ monitoring.

To expand our product offering with a new hardware, we need insights into how we can redesign our existing popular microplastics analytics platform, MPConnect, to incorporate state of the art data logging capabilities with a smart sensor.

AbbaTek aims to enhance its impact on environmental sustainability and advance its mission of innovative solutions for a healthier planet.

Deliverables

The final deliverables include:

  • A report on the research, findings, and general design recommendations for hydrological monitoring using open hardware sensors in the field.
  • Build a prototype of the recommended design for a data logging system to be included in our new line of hardware sensors for microplastics monitoring in aquatic environments.

Unabted plastic production and mismanaged waste has resulted in a plastic pollution crisis that spans the globe and negatively impacts human, animal, and ecosystem health. The plastics life cycle also significantly contributes to climate change. AbbaTek Group Inc., the creators of MPConnect, is a cleantech company dedicated to addressing emerging environmental data management problems, beginning with the issue of microplastics. As a social enterprise registered in Newfoundland and Labrador, Canada, AbbaTek combines technological development, institutional change, and social impact.
